Mercy Brown Gears Up For West Coast Tour
Spokane alt-metal band Mercy Brown is pleased to reveal news of embarking on a tour of the west coast this week. The tour will consist of 14 dates from March 10th to the 25th.
Frontwoman Sera Hatchett commented: "We're looking forward to getting on the road again and making our way to Southern California for the first time, and back up to Boise to play Treefort Music Fest. Hope to see you soon!"
In addition to embarking on the tour, the band also recently released a video for the track "Codependent," which is taken from Mercy Brown's self-titled 2015 album.

Mercy Brown Offering Track For Download
The genre-bending metallers from Mercy Brown have unveiled one of the songs from their self-titled début album, a stormer entitled "Codependent" that sees vocalist Sera Hatchett croon and shriek over the deafening roar of death metal.
You can stream the track below, or grab a free download of "Codependent" by heading over to PureGrainAudio.com here.
PureGrainAudio commented, “A lot of groups say they're 'unique,' 'original,' or 'new,' but you know what, these guys actually are. Sera Hatchett (vocals), Chris Tanaka Canwell (guitar), Josh Schultz (bass), and Lunden Herndon (drums) have a ton of varying influences and manage to blend them all into Mercy Brown's music.” More...
Mercy Brown Streaming "Birds"
Washington metal outfit Mercy Brown has unveiled a track from the band's debut self-titled record, courtesy of MetalRecusants.
“Birds” is a ripping start to the album; after the unsettling intro “From The Sky,” “Birds” flares up with dirty death metal riffing and Sera Hatchett’s vicious growls, which switches to soothing crooning for the chorus. Mercy Brown is:
